Vincent Motorcycles, 'the makers of the world's fastest motorcycles', was established in 1928 when Phil Vincent bought the rights to HRD Motors Ltd. after the company went into voluntary liquidation. With the backing of his family, Vincent acquired the trademark, goodwill and remaining components for £450, renaming the new company Vincent HRD. Initially, motorcycles were sold under the HRD name, using their own frames with proprietary engines. However, in 1934 two new engines were developed, a 500cc single and a 1,000cc V-twin. Always the innovator, Vincent now had full control over his products and began introducing many design features that proved to be ahead of their time, such as cantilevered rear suspension. In 1949, in order to avoid confusion with Harley-Davidson in the USA, they began to use simply the Vincent name on their products. The bikes were the most desirable motorcycles in the world at the time and with some astute marketing, became the machines that everyone aspired to own. The 500cc Comets and the 1000cc Rapides and Black Shadows have become some of the most revered and collectable bikes of their era.
This matching-numbers 1939 HRD Comet was purchased by the current owner as a restoration project around eight years ago. After examining it and identifying the missing components, he set about searching for the few items that needed to be sourced. A couple of years later, work began to restore the Comet to an exactingly high standard. The project finally reached completion earlier this year, and the present condition of the bike testifies as to the quality of the work. We have observed the Comet start and run happily, though it still needs running in plus a few basic checks before being used in earnest. It is accompanied by a current V5, a Vincent Dating Certificate and some images of the restoration.
